WebCalculating Aeration Flow and Pressure Requirements WebThis resistance to flow is defined by an equation of the form: P = K p Q n (eq.4) Where P = pressure drop inches of water (inches w.g.). Q = airflow in cu. ft/min (CFM). K = a constant determined by the characteristics of the system. n = a constant depending upon the type of flow. p = density of air in lb. per cubic foot. WebTo calculate the required equipment size, divide the HVAC load for the entire building by 12,000. One ton equals 12,000 BTUs, so if a house or office needs 24,000 BTUs, it will take a 2-ton HVAC unit. Air flow is the volume of air that is produced by the fan measured by time. In this case, the air flow of a fan is measured in cubic meters per minute (m³/min) in metric units, or cubic feet per minute (CFM) in imperial units.
